Top 10 ‘Self-Sustaining Energy Grids’ for luxury estates to achieve 2026 independence:

1. Tesla Powerwall – Tesla’s Powerwall is a leading energy storage solution for luxury estates, with a production volume of 100,000 units in 2020. Its innovative technology allows homeowners to store excess energy generated from solar panels for later use.

2. SunPower Equinox – SunPower’s Equinox system is a top choice for luxury estates looking to achieve energy independence. With a market share of 20% in the residential solar market, SunPower is a trusted brand in the industry.

3. LG Chem RESU – LG Chem’s RESU battery is a popular choice for luxury estates seeking a reliable energy storage solution. With exports to over 40 countries, LG Chem is a global leader in battery technology.

4. Sonnen Eco – Sonnen’s Eco system is known for its high-performance energy storage capabilities, making it a top choice for luxury estates. Sonnen has a trade value of $500 million in the energy storage market.

5. Generac PWRcell – Generac’s PWRcell system is a top contender in the self-sustaining energy grid market, with a production volume of 50,000 units in 2020. Generac is a trusted name in backup power solutions.

6. Enphase Ensemble – Enphase’s Ensemble system offers a reliable energy management solution for luxury estates. With a market share of 15% in the residential solar market, Enphase is a key player in the industry.

7. SMA Sunny Boy Storage – SMA’s Sunny Boy Storage system is a popular choice for luxury estates seeking energy independence. SMA has a trade value of $300 million in the energy storage market.

8. Panasonic EverVolt – Panasonic’s EverVolt battery system is a top performer in the self-sustaining energy grid market. With exports to over 50 countries, Panasonic is a global leader in energy solutions.

9. SolarEdge StorEdge – SolarEdge’s StorEdge system is a leading energy storage solution for luxury estates. SolarEdge has a production volume of 80,000 units in 2020, making it a top player in the industry.

10. Schneider Electric Conext – Schneider Electric’s Conext system is a trusted choice for luxury estates looking to achieve energy independence. Schneider Electric has a market share of 10% in the residential solar market.
